CPU pricing for industrial and embedded computers is not a single figure but a spectrum defined by the processor's performance tier, generation, and the overall system configuration. The price of a new CPU is intrinsically linked to the complete computing solution it powers. For businesses and integrators, the total cost of ownership, which includes reliability, power efficiency, and long-term support, is often more critical than the standalone processor cost.
Key specifications that influence the price include the processor brand (Intel or ARM), the series (e.g., Intel N-series, Core i3/i5), and the generation (e.g., 12th, 14th). Higher core counts, faster clock speeds, and larger cache memory typically command a premium. For example, an Intel Core i5-1240P with 12 cores will be part of a higher-priced system than an Intel N100 with 4 cores. Similarly, ARM-based systems using Cortex-A series processors often offer a compelling price-to-performance ratio for specific, less demanding workloads.
Common Use Cases by CPU Tier:
-
Entry-Level (e.g., Intel N100, ARM Cortex-A55): Ideal for digital signage, thin clients, kiosks, and basic IoT gateways where low power consumption and cost are paramount.
-
Mid-Range (e.g., Intel Core i3-1215U): Suited for industrial automation, edge computing, more advanced digital signage, and as compact workstations for office productivity.
-
High-Performance (e.g., Intel Core i5-1240P, Core 5 120U): Designed for demanding applications like machine vision, AI inference at the edge, sophisticated control systems, and as powerful mini workstations.
| Processor Tier | Example Model | Typical Cores | Use Case Focus | Relative System Cost |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Entry-Level / Value | Intel N100, ARM Cortex-A53/A55 | 4 | Thin Client, Basic Kiosk | Low |
| Mainstream / Balanced | Intel Core i3-1215U | 6 | Industrial PC, Office Mini PC | Medium |
| Performance | Intel Core i5-1240P | 12 | Edge AI, Advanced Automation | High |
| Latest Generation | Intel Core 5 120U (14th Gen) | 10 | High-Performance Mini Workstation | Premium |
